The Cherry Creek High School Interact club (sponsored by our club) supported the 2010 Adams Camp dance for disabled teens. The club sent volunteers to the dance, who reported they had a great experience.
The club collected $14,000 to purchase Shelter Boxes for distribution in Haiti. Each Shelter box contains a tent and supplies for 10 people. The club collected enough for about 28 boxes, bringing shelter and supplies to 280 people. See also Rotary aid to Haiti.
Several hundred illustrated dictionaries were distributed by the club in December to 3rd graders at Mammoth Heights and Pine Lake elementary schools in Douglas county. Click for more picturesMore...
